When you look into tax debt relief, the total cost depends on a few specific variables. A specialist considers the total amount of money you owe to the IRS, how many years of back taxes are involved, and whether you are facing active collection actions like liens or levies. Complexity is the main driver; resolving a simple filing error costs much less than negotiating an Offer in Compromise or setting up a long-term installment agreement for a large balance. Yes, the IRS offers several programs designed to help taxpayers manage and resolve their tax debt. These programs can include installment agreements, Offer in Compromise, and penalty abatement. A licensed professional can assess your situation to see if you qualify for these relief options.
Eligibility for tax relief programs generally depends on your specific financial circumstances and the type of tax debt you have. The IRS will look at your income, expenses, and assets. Professionals can help you understand the criteria and gather the necessary documentation for your San Bernardino case.
The IRS settlement amount, often through an Offer in Compromise, is determined on a case-by-case basis. It usually reflects what the IRS believes it can realistically collect given your financial situation. A tax relief specialist can guide you through the process and help you make a reasonable offer.
